# Diagnosing Superpowers
|
||
|
||
## Overview
|
||
|
||
Pin down with your human partner what went wrong in a session, read the
|
||
transcripts on disk, and report what happened with evidence. You report;
|
||
you do not diagnose superpowers. Whoever triages the bundle or the issue
|
||
decides whether superpowers changes.
|
||
|
||
**Core principle:** Every finding cites `path:line`. No citation, no
|
||
finding. Every number comes from the transcript or from a command you ran,
|
||
never from memory.

## Workflow
|
||
|
||
Create a todo per step. Steps 5–7 run only on their stated condition.
|
||
|
||
1. **Problem intake.** Ask one question at a time until you can write a
|
||
statement naming the session(s), the turn range if known, what your
|
||
partner expected, what happened, and the observable they care about
|
||
(wall-clock, tokens, repeated actions, one specific action). "It took
|
||
too long" is a complaint, not a problem statement. Note whether the
|
||
goal is a superpowers bug report.
|
||
2. **Locate.** Resolve each session to exact paths using
|
||
`references/claude-code-sessions.md`, `references/codex-sessions.md`,
|
||
or `references/other-harnesses.md` for any other harness. Confirm a
|
||
past session by quoting its first prompt and timestamp, and list every
|
||
candidate you rejected with the reason, or "none". Enumerate subagent
|
||
transcripts. Create
|
||
`~/.superpowers/diagnosing-superpowers/<session-id>/`, tell your
|
||
partner the path, and fill `templates/case.md` there, including the
|
||
superpowers install root, version, git sha, and a sha1 for every skill
|
||
file the session read or had injected.
|
||
3. **Triage.** Read the region around the reported problem yourself. Then
|
||
dispatch one analyst subagent per dimension in parallel, each given the
|
||
case file path and one file from `prompts/`: `skill-timeline.md`,
|
||
`plan-adherence.md`, `repeated-work.md`, `stumbles.md`,
|
||
`quality-evidence.md`, `request-conflicts.md`, `cost-and-time.md`.
|
||
Split a dimension by turn range when the transcript is long. Discard
|
||
any returned finding without `path:line`.
|
||
4. **Report.** Fill every section of `templates/report.md` in order, write
|
||
it to the workspace, show it, and give the path.
|
||
5. **GitHub issues** — when report §7 says possible or likely, or your
|
||
partner asks. Search open and closed issues on `obra/superpowers` for
|
||
the symptoms (`gh` if installed, else the public search API with curl,
|
||
else hand over a search URL). Show matches and suggest adding the
|
||
report to the closest. If none match, draft `templates/issue.md`, show
|
||
the exact text, and create it only after approval. `gh issue create`
|
||
cannot attach files; give your partner the bundle path to attach.
|
||
6. **Export** — when asked, or the intake goal was a bug report. Ask the
|
||
redaction level: skeleton, evidence, or full. Tell your partner that if
|
||
this is for reporting a bug in superpowers, the more information they
|
||
can provide, the better the chance the maintainers can help. Build the
|
||
bundle per `templates/bundle-README.md`, dispatch `prompts/scrub.md`, then
|
||
`prompts/scrub-audit.md`, repeating both until the audit returns CLEAN.
|
||
Show the scrub log and file list; archive (`zip -r` or `tar -czf`)
|
||
only after approval, and report the archive path.
|
||
7. **Similar sessions** — when asked. Turn confirmed findings into a
|
||
signature, list candidates by mtime and size, find marker line numbers,
|
||
dispatch `prompts/similar-session.md` per candidate in parallel, and
|
||
append report §9.

## Hard rules
|
||
|
||
- **Context safety.** One transcript line can be a megabyte. Check
|
||
`wc -lc` and long lines first. Never `cat` or `grep` for content: line
|
||
numbers and counts, then trimmed fields from specific lines.
|
||
- **Read-only.** Never modify, move, or delete a session file.
|
||
- **Exact paths to subagents.** A subagent's "current session" is its
|
||
own. Pass absolute paths and ids.
|
||
- **Human prompts only.** Hook output, system reminders, and tool results
|
||
are not your partner's words. In a subagent transcript, "user" is the
|
||
parent agent.
|
||
- **No superpowers diagnosis.** Report §7 states involvement and stops.
|
||
Never name a defect in a skill or propose a change. Pushing does not
|
||
waive this; point at the issue step and offer the bundle. No advice to
|
||
your partner either.
|
||
- **Approval gates.** No archive before your partner has seen the scrub
|
||
log and file list. No issue or comment before they approve the exact
|
||
text.
|
||
- **Intake before analysis.** Nothing in steps 2–7 starts until your
|
||
partner has answered. If they are away, write the questions and stop.
|
||
A statement you reconstructed for them is not an answer. An
|
||
already-scoped request — one specific event, what is running now, or
|
||
the analysis to run — is itself the statement: answer it, then ask.
|
||
A whole-session "why" is a complaint.
